-
JamesTait joined the channel
-
JamesTait
Good morning all! Happy Monday, and happy Hug a Bear Day! 😃 🐻
-
CheapSeth joined the channel
-
CheapSeth has quit
-
ElNounch_ has quit
-
feliwir has quit
-
rom1504 has quit
-
feliwir joined the channel
-
ElNounch_ joined the channel
-
rom1504 joined the channel
-
JamesTait has quit
-
CheapSeth joined the channel
-
NOTICE: [cuberite] madmaxoft pushed 1 new commit to master: https://git.io/vX0LG
-
NOTICE: cuberite/master 0870649 Mattes D: Fixed TrappedChest saving. (#3423)...
-
CheapSeth has quit
-
warmist_ joined the channel
-
JulianLaubstein[ joined the channel
-
guenstig_werben
Anyone here? Puretryout[m]?
-
PureTryOut[m]
yes
-
guenstig_werben
Wanna join the server on my phone?
-
It's finally working.....
-
(Tigerw is also there)
-
PureTryOut[m]
lol no sorry doing other stuff
-
but good job ;)
-
guenstig_werben
:c
-
Anyone else
-
PureTryOut[m]
I'm not sure why anyone would want a server on their phone anyway but sure ;)
-
yangm97
guenstig_werben: like some java-pe crossplay?
-
guenstig_werben
@sphinxcore?
-
JulianLaubstein[
Yup
-
guenstig_werben
No, like I've got a fully fledged minecraft server on my phone online
-
yangm97
oh boy I miss android
-
guenstig_werben
Yang wanna try it out?
-
PureTryOut[m]
TIL Julian Laubstein == sphinxc0re and uses Matrix
-
guenstig_werben
Connect with your standard minecraft client.... I know puretryout :p
-
PureTryOut[m]
what?
-
guenstig_werben
That he's sphinxc0re
-
yangm97
guenstig_werben: why not
-
PureTryOut[m]
guenstig_werben: well yeah cause on IRC you see him as sphinxc0re
-
I however see him (on Matrix) as Julian Laubstein
-
JulianLaubstein[
Matrix rocks
-
PureTryOut[m]
+1
-
definitely does
-
yangm97
+2
-
guenstig_werben
Nah I see him as JulianLaubstein[....
-
What is matrix?
-
PureTryOut[m]
opoh ;)
-
-
yangm97
I'm looking forward modding the IRC bridge to bridge directly into matrix
-
PureTryOut[m]
tl;dr: decentralized (federated to be exact), FOSS, encrypted chat protocol
-
Yan Minari: why not a direct Matrix bridge?
-
the bridge IRC to Matrix and done :d
-
:D
-
yangm97
that's what I meant
-
there's the cs api in lua
-
PureTryOut[m]
aah ok
-
guenstig_werben
Nest
-
yangm97
and there is an irc plugin for cuberite
-
guenstig_werben
Whars the big difference to xmpp?
-
yangm97
hope I can reuse most of the code
-
JulianLaubstein[
Xmpp is not federated
-
Or is it?
-
yangm97
Xmpp is a set of uncertainty
-
there is this spec that some clients support but others don't
-
JulianLaubstein[
^^
-
PureTryOut[m]
-
yangm97
some servers are federated, some don't
-
also, there's the cloud thing: messages sync across your devices
-
guenstig_werben
So what do I need to do? If I understand it correctly it acts as irc bouncer and communications platform
-
PureTryOut[m]
well no... it ends up being a IRC bouncer as well, but is definitely not meant to be
-
yangm97
kinda. since we know everyone won't switch to matrix overnight there's this strong concept of bridges
-
guenstig_werben
Yeah but the best use case for me is preliminary irc bouncer and then some other computation platform
-
PureTryOut[m]
compare Matrix to email. people will all be registered to different servers, and the servers are the ones talking to each other
-
aah well then yes it's basically a bouncer
-
yangm97
you can connect a matrix room to slack, irc, gitter and other servies. there are the so called bridges
-
PureTryOut[m]
and it syncs PM's and such across devices
-
guenstig_werben
And how many bridges are there? I don't want to write everything myself
-
yangm97
I will be trying to make a bridge matrix <-> minecraft for instance
-
PureTryOut[m]
guenstig_werben: currently to Slack, Gitter, and 3 IRC networks (Freenode, Snoonet and Mozilla)
-
I believe OFTC will be the next IRC network connected
-
woops no OFTC is already connected
-
NOTICE: [cuberite] tigerw force-pushed android from 0c498bf to 9131615: https://git.io/vshwP
-
NOTICE: cuberite/android cec2e68 Tiger Wang: Converted to android-cmake for Android building
-
NOTICE: cuberite/android 4fee082 Tiger Wang: Compilation fix attempt
-
NOTICE: cuberite/android 26127d3 Tiger Wang: test
-
guenstig_werben
You need a Bridger for each network?
-
Damn Tiger... Why? :o
-
PureTryOut[m]
obviously...
-
it's how IRC works
-
they are all seperate
-
but 1 Matrix room can be connected to multiple IRC networks at the same time
-
yangm97
the code is the same for all network, it just happens these are oficially hosted by matrix devs
-
PureTryOut[m]
so that way you can talk on Freenode with people from Snoonet if you wanted too
-
guenstig_werben
I mean the protocol is the same....
-
PureTryOut[m]
ooh no that way
-
codebase is the same
-
it just has to be setup per network
-
guenstig_werben
And which server do you use for matrix? Everyone his own?
-
yangm97
I think they're rolling on a per-network basis for resources reason
-
guenstig_werben
&their
-
PureTryOut[m]
-
mostly because I'm too lazy to setup my own
-
yangm97
I'm using the
matrix.org server, but I could be using my own or any other
-
guenstig_werben
OK.....
-
yangm97
in fact I think i'm going to set up my own server for the minecraft bridge
-
time will tell
-
I'm also looking forward bridging telegram
-
PureTryOut[m]
there is already a bridge in the works actually
-
yangm97
telematrix
-
PureTryOut[m]
[Telematrix](https://github.com/sijmenschoon/telematrix)
-
indeed
-
guenstig_werben
Do we have a cuberite Chatroom there?
-
PureTryOut[m]
yes, this one :p
-
we could make a proper integrated one though, but there isn't really any benefit to it for us
-
yangm97
just a shame there's no public hs for as playground
-
I'm sure more bridges would be up already
-
guenstig_werben
So we need an irc bridge
-
PureTryOut[m]
what...?
-
yangm97
-
this is how matrix looks on riot.im, connected to this IRC channel
-
PureTryOut[m]
macOS :(
-
yangm97
PureTryOut: why so sad?
-
PureTryOut[m]
not FOSS :(
-
yangm97
oh uhm... pretend this is a linux theme them :P
-
PureTryOut[m]
lol
-
JulianLaubstein[
I'm using macOS, too
-
PureTryOut[m]
wut? seriously? I thought you really cared about FOSS?
-
JulianLaubstein[
I do
-
yangm97 high-fives Julian
-
PureTryOut[m]
but you use macOS?
-
guenstigwerben[m joined the channel
-
ooh hey welcome to Matrix guenstig werben
-
JulianLaubstein[
Has nothing to do with me caring about FOSS ^^
-
guenstigwerben[m
Hi
-
guenstig_werben
Can I ever get rid of the [m]?
-
PureTryOut[m]
well macOS isn't FOSS, so I would think it does matter
-
guenstig_werben: yeah
-
guenstigwerben[m
Oh this is neat
-
yangm97
I think I got rid of the [m]
-
PureTryOut[m]
when you joined this room you should've gotten some invites for other rooms
-
one of them should be ChanServ
-
accept it, and send `!nick guenstig_werben` to it
-
guenstigwerben[m
Yeah what are they for?
-
PureTryOut[m]
make sure you disconnect your IRC client first
-
guenstigwerben[m
Ah...
-
Does it support freenode s login?
-
/msg ChanServ identify
-
yangm97
yep
-
guenstigwerben[m
... Not
-
yangm97
you just need to send a pm to chamserv